The Ultimate Buying Guide: Choosing the Right Wood Moisture Tester

Whether you are a professional carpenter or a weekend woodworker, managing moisture is critical. Wet wood shrinks, warps, and causes structural failure. A wood moisture tester is the best tool to prevent these problems. This guide will help you choose the right device for your projects.

Key Features to Look For

First, check the measurement range. Most testers measure between 5% and 40% moisture content. If you work with very dry wood, ensure the device has a low-range sensor. Next, look for a large digital display. A backlit screen helps you read numbers in dark workshops. Finally, look for automatic calibration. This feature keeps your readings accurate without extra work.

Understanding Materials and Design

Moisture meters generally come in two types: pin-type and pinless. Pin-type meters use two metal prongs to touch the wood fibers. They provide deep readings but leave tiny holes in the surface. Pinless meters use electromagnetic sensors to scan the wood. These are great for finished furniture because they do not damage the surface.

Factors That Affect Quality

Accuracy depends on the quality of the internal sensors. Professional-grade tools use high-quality circuits to provide stable readings. Cheap models often fluctuate or provide false data. Another factor is species correction. Different types of wood have different densities. A high-quality meter allows you to input the wood species to adjust for these density differences.

User Experience and Use Cases

Think about how you will use the tool. If you are building a deck, a rugged pin-type meter is perfect. If you are buying reclaimed lumber for a fine table, a pinless meter is better. Most users prefer ergonomic designs that fit comfortably in one hand. Simple one-button operation also makes the job faster and less frustrating.

10 Frequently Asked Questions

Q: Do I need a professional-grade meter?

A: If you build furniture for sale, yes. If you are just checking firewood, a basic hobbyist model works fine.

Q: What is the ideal moisture content for indoor furniture?

A: Most indoor wood should be between 6% and 8% moisture content.

Q: Can I use a moisture meter on painted wood?

A: You can use a pinless meter through paint. Pin-type meters require direct contact with the wood fibers.

Q: How often should I calibrate my meter?

A: Check the manual. Most modern meters self-calibrate every time you turn them on.

Q: Do batteries come included?

A: Many brands include a 9V battery, but always check the product box to be sure.

Q: Will a pin-type meter ruin my wood?

A: It leaves two tiny pinprick holes. These are usually easy to hide with a bit of wood filler.

Q: Does temperature affect the reading?

A: Yes. Extreme cold or heat can change the sensor accuracy. Keep your meter at room temperature when possible.

Q: Can I measure concrete with these?

A: Only if the meter has a specific mode for building materials. Do not use a wood-only meter on concrete.

Q: How deep do the sensors read?

A: Pin-type meters read as deep as you push the pins. Pinless meters usually scan about 0.75 inches deep.

Q: What happens if the wood is too wet?

A: The meter will show an “Out of Range” warning. This means the wood is not ready for construction.
